
(LifeSiteNews) David Benham, one of the Benham Brothers, was arrested Saturday while sidewalk counseling outside an abortion center in Charlotte, North Carolina. Several members of Love Life, a pro-life group active in North Carolina, were also arrested, including three pastors.
Senator Ted Cruz, R-TX, called Benham’s arrest “unconstitutional.”
The Benham Brothers, David and Jason, gained significant media attention in 2014. At the time, HGTV canceled a proposed reality TV show that was going to feature the pro-life and pro-family evangelicals.